Strabismus is a condition characterized by the misalignment of the eyes, where one eye may look straight ahead while the other turns in, out, up, or down. This misalignment can affect one or both eyes and may be constant or intermittent. The causes of strabismus can be multifactorial, including genetic predisposition, muscle imbalances around the eyes, neurological issues, or refractive errors, such as uncorrected farsightedness which may lead to the eyes drifting. Environmental factors, such as premature birth or conditions such as Down syndrome, can also contribute to the development of strabismus. The symptoms of this condition may vary, but they often include double vision, poor depth perception, difficulty focusing on objects, and abnormal head posture, where individuals might tilt or turn their head to achieve better alignment of their eyes. Children with strabismus may squint or close one eye in bright light, and they may experience challenges in daily activities that require good vision, such as reading or playing sports. Importantly, early detection and intervention are crucial, as untreated strabismus can lead to further complications, including amblyopia, commonly known as “lazy eye.” Affected individuals may struggle with social interactions due to concerns about appearance, leading to psychological impacts such as low self-esteem and anxiety. Various management options are available for strabismus, and the approach is typically tailored to the underlying cause, age of the patient, and severity of the condition. In many cases, corrective glasses or contact lenses can be prescribed to address refractive errors and improve alignment. Furthermore, vision therapy may be employed to strengthen the eye muscles and improve coordination, often involving exercises designed to enhance eye tracking and focusing abilities. In more severe cases, surgical intervention may be necessary to adjust the muscles responsible for eye positioning. Surgery involves repositioning or strengthening the extraocular muscles to achieve better alignment of the eyes, and this procedure can be particularly beneficial in children, as it may also stimulate the visual system and prevent amblyopia. Postoperative care is essential to monitor progress and ensure successful alignment, with follow-up examinations often required to assess the outcome and make any adjustments if necessary. While strabismus can present challenges for those affected, a multidisciplinary approach involving pediatricians, optometrists, and ophthalmologists can provide effective management strategies to improve visual function and quality of life. Regular check-ups and timely interventions can make a significant difference in the treatment of strabismus, allowing individuals to lead more fulfilling lives with improved eye alignment and vision.
